Key Inductees and Their Achievements

  • Anthony Muñoz: An offensive tackle known for his exceptional technique and leadership. Muñoz was a 11-time Pro Bowler and is considered one of the greatest offensive linemen in NFL history.
  • Ken Anderson: A quarterback who led the Bengals to multiple playoff appearances and was named NFL Most Valuable Player in 1981. Anderson’s precision passing set numerous team records.
  • Carl Pickens: Wide receiver known for his spectacular catches and consistent performance. Pickens ranks among the franchise’s top receivers in yards and touchdowns.
